HAM AND PINEAPPLE HAWAIIAN SLIDERS



Ham and Pineapple Hawaiian Sliders image

Hawaiian ham, pineapple and mozzarella cheese sliders recipe that is easy to make with King's Hawaiian rolls brushed with a melted butter and mustard glaze.

Provided by Steve Cylka

Categories     Appetizer

Time 35m

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 package 12 pack dinner rolls (, ex. Kings Hawaiian)
14-18 slices black forest ham lunchmeat (, about 200 grams (1/2 pound))
1 can pineapple tidbits (, drained)
2 cups grated mozzarella cheese
1/4 cup butter (, melted)
1 tbsp mustard (, or dijon)
1 tbsp brown sugar
1/2 tsp garlic powder

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325F.
  • Keeping the 12 dinner rolls together, cut them lengthwise. Place bottom half in a greased 13x9 inch baking pan.
  • Lay summer ham slices evenly across the bottom half of the dinner rolls. Continue evenly spread the pineapple tidbits and grated cheese on top of the ham. Place the top half of the dinner rolls on top.
  • Whisk together the melted butter, mustard, brown sugar and garlic powder. Brush this butter mixture on the top of the dinner rolls.
  • Cover the baking pan with foil and bake for 15 minutes.
  • Remove foil and bake of another 10-15 minutes. The buns should be starting to brown and the cheese melted and bubbling on the sides.
  • Cut into sliders and serve warm.

HAM PANCAKE SLIDERS WITH PINEAPPLE SAUCE



Ham Pancake Sliders with Pineapple Sauce image

B Smith, restauranteur, author, and respected expert in affordable-yet-elegant living shares a delicious recipe! Looking for a hearty breakfast made using Original Bisquick® mix? Then try these ham pancakes that are topped with pineapple sauce - ready in 25 minutes.

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Breakfast

Time 25m

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 can (8 oz) crushed pineapple
1/2 cup pineapple preserves
1 tablespoon brown sugar
1/2 teaspoon ground ginger
1/4 to 1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es
2 packages (6 oz each) Canadian bacon slices
2 cups Original Bisquick™ mix
1 1/4 cups milk
2 eggs

Steps:

  • In 1-quart saucepan, combine all sauce ingredients. Heat to boiling; reduce heat to medium. Cook and stir about 2 minutes or until mixture is slightly thickened. Remove from heat; cool to room temperature.
  • Heat oven to 300F. Place Canadian bacon slices on 15x 10-inch baking sheet. Place in oven until hot and ready to serve.
  • In medium bowl, stir together Bisquick, milk and eggs. Spoon about 2 tablespoons batter for each pancake onto hot griddle. Cook until edges are dry; turn. Cook until golden brown.
  • To make sliders; place one slice Canadian bacon on each of 10 pancakes; top with pineapple sauce and additional pancake.

HAM SLICES WITH PINEAPPLE



Ham Slices with Pineapple image

"My husband is so fond of this dish that I often double the recipe," reports Donna Warner of Tavares, Florida. "I mix the leftovers with macaroni and cheese and add a can of cheddar cheese soup for a quick casserole."

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 20m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 can (8-1/4 ounces) sliced pineapple
2 slices fully cooked ham (3 ounces each)
1 tablespoon butter
1-1/2 teaspoons cornstarch
3/4 teaspoon ground mustard
3 tablespoons sherry or apple juice

Steps:

  • Drain pineapple, reserving juice. Add enough water to juice to measure 1/2 cup; set aside. In a large nonstick skillet, lightly brown pineapple and ham. Remove and keep warm. , In the same skillet, melt butter. Whisk in cornstarch and mustard until smooth. Stir in sherry or apple juice and reserved pineapple juice.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thickened. Serve with ham and pineapple.

HAM SLIDERS WITH SWEET-AND-SOUR PINEAPPLE MARMALADE



Ham Sliders with Sweet-and-Sour Pineapple Marmalade image

"Pineapples symbolize hospitality and friendship," says Katie.

Provided by Katie Lee Biegel

Categories     main-dish

Time 25m

Yield 8 to 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/2 cup fresh orange juice (from 2 oranges)
1/4 cup white wine vinegar
3 tablespoons packed light brown sugar
2 cups chopped pineapple (from 1/2 medium pineapple)
2 tablespoons minced red onion
1 jalapeno pepper, minced (remove ribs and seeds for a milder marmalade)
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
1/2 pound thinly sliced ham
8 to 12 potato slider buns

Steps:

  • Whisk the orange juice, vinegar, brown sugar and 2 tablespoons water in a medium saucepan over medium-high heat until the sugar dissolves, about 2 minutes. Add the pineapple, red onion and jalapeno. Bring to a low boil, then reduce the heat to a simmer. Cook, stirring occasionally, until the mixture thickens, 15 to 30 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Let cool.
  • Divide the ham among the buns. Top with the pineapple marmalade.

SIMPLE PINEAPPLE SAUCE FOR HAM



Simple Pineapple Sauce for Ham image

This simple pineapple sauce is so delicious and easy to make. I got the recipe from my Sister-in-law. Leftovers are great served warm, over vanilla ice cream. I love it with a Honey Baked Ham.

Provided by JTsMom

Categories     Sauces

Time 20m

Yield 2 1/2 cups, 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 (8 ounce) cans crushed pineapple, in juice (do not drain)
1 cup brown sugar, packed
1 tablespoon cornstarch
1/4 teaspoon salt
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1/2-1 tablespoon Dijon mustard (start with less and adjust to your taste)

Steps:

  • In a small sauce pan mix the brown sugar, cornstarch and salt.
  • Stir in undrained crushed pineapple, lemon juice and mustard.
  •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ly until mixture thickens and comes to a boil.
  • Boil while stirring for 1 minute.
  • Serve warm with ham.

HAM WITH PINEAPPLE SAUCE



Ham With Pineapple Sauce image

Make and share this Ham With Pineapple Sauce recipe from Food.com.

Provided by ratherbeswimmin

Categories     Ham

Time 2h30m

Yield 18 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

6 lbs boneless ham (fully cooked)
3/4 cup water, divided
1 cup brown sugar, firmly packed
4 1/2 teaspoons soy sauce
4 1/2 teaspoons ketchup
1 1/2 teaspoons ground mustard
1 1/2 cups crushed pineapple, undrained
2 tablespoons cornstarch, plus
1 teaspoon cornstarch

Steps:

  • Place ham on a rack in a shallow roasting pan.
  • Bake at 325°F for 1 1/4 to 2 hours or until a meat thermometer reads 140°F and ham is heated through.
  • Meanwhile, in a saucepan, combine 1/4 cup water, brown sugar, soy sauce, ketchup, mustard, and pineapple.
  • Bring to a boil; reduce heat, cover and simmer for 10 minutes.
  • Combine cornstarch and remaining water until smooth; stir into pineapple sauce.
  •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thickened.
  • Serve with the ham.
